Yeah there's two ways to look at this: performances on the pitch and cold hard business. Performance wise I think Valdes has won us the most points based on his individual displays. Chambers and Fabio have done well too. But in terms of business then I think Ramirez and Traore have been key signings. I think this season we're "doing a bit of a Burnley" as if we go down I think we'll be well placed on the pitch and financially to continue to build and get promoted again. Our transfer strategy since promotion hasn't been to throw the kitchen sink at keeping up. If we were to get relegated then we will have a valuable squad where we won't be stuck with loads of deadwood as we were after the 2008-2009 season so I think we'd be well placed to bounce back. Clubs will be queuing up for the likes of Valdes, Gibson, Traore and Ramirez if we get relegated so we will have a battle to keep them.
